Navigating Growing Anti-ESG Sentiment: Recent Developments Impacting Asset Managers

Ropes & Gray

June 8, 2023
On-Demand
Podcast

Most of the focus has been on asset managers. As the leading asset management practice, Ropes & Gray has been in the trenches advising clients on these issues on a daily basis.

On this podcast, Ropes & Gray thought leaders come together for a timely in-depth discussion of the most recent anti-ESG developments and the demands asset managers are navigating. During the podcast, they discuss fiduciary duties (01:55), antitrust (13:55), proxy advisors (21:27), state legislation (23:22), greenwashing and consumer protection claims (44:50) and ERISA considerations (52:23). The participants provide concrete compliance tips. They also provide their predictions for the future (59:07).

Ropes & Gray partners Josh Lichtenstein, Samer Musallam, Chong Park, Amy Roy and Rob Skinner share their thoughts. The discussion is moderated by Michael Littenberg, partner and global head of the firm’s ESG, CSR and business & human rights practice.
